shader: Add support for "negative" and unaligned offsets
"Negative" offsets don't exist. They are shown as such due to a bug in nvdisasm. Unaligned offsets have been proved to read the aligned offset. For example, when reading an U32, if the offset is 6, the offset read will be 4.
